Verse 7
1 Chronicles 21:7
Noah Webster Bible
7
And God (Elohim) was displeased with this thing, therefore he smote Israel.
Original Language Text
hebrew
וַ/יֵּ֨רַע֙ בְּ/עֵינֵ֣י הָ/אֱלֹהִ֔ים עַל הַ/דָּבָ֖ר הַ/זֶּ֑ה וַ/יַּ֖ךְ אֶת יִשְׂרָאֵֽל
English Translation
And it was evil in the eyes of God concerning this matter, and He struck Israel.
